# VSM Concept Schema v1.0 Schema definition for Viable System Model concept documents. ## Required Sections ### Definition A clear, concise definition of the VSM concept (20-200 words). ### System Classification Which VSM system(s) this concept belongs to. Must reference at least one of: - System 1 (Operations) - System 2 (Coordination) - System 3 (Control) - System 3* (Audit) - System 4 (Intelligence) - System 5 (Policy) ### Key Properties Bulleted list of essential properties or characteristics of this concept. ### Relationships How this concept relates to other VSM concepts. List related concepts and the nature of the relationship (e.g., "regulates", "enables", "constrains"). ## Optional Sections ### Examples Concrete examples illustrating the concept in organisational contexts. ### Beer's Original Formulation Direct reference to how Stafford Beer originally described or defined this concept, with citation to the relevant work. ## Validation Rules 1. The document MUST contain an H1 heading with the concept name. 2. The document MUST contain all four required sections: Definition, System Classification, Key Properties, Relationships. 3. The Definition section MUST be between 20 and 200 words. 4. The System Classification section MUST reference at least one VSM system (S1-S5 or S3*).
